Understanding Terraform Cloud

Terraform, developed by HashiCorp, is an open-source tool that allows users to define and provision data center infrastructure using a high-level configuration language known as HashiCorp Configuration Language (HCL). Terraform Cloud is the managed service version that provides additional features and capabilities designed to facilitate collaboration, governance, and automation in infrastructure management.

Key Benefits of Terraform Cloud

  1. Collaborative Infrastructure ManagementOne of the standout features of Terraform Cloud is its ability to foster collaboration among team members. With built-in version control integrations, teams can work together seamlessly on infrastructure changes. Key collaborative features include:

    • Workspaces: Terraform Cloud allows teams to create separate workspaces for different environments (e.g., development, staging, production), enabling parallel development without interference.

    • Version Control Integration: By integrating with popular version control systems like GitHub and GitLab, teams can manage infrastructure changes through pull requests, ensuring that all modifications are reviewed and approved before deployment.

  2. Automated WorkflowsAutomation is at the heart of Terraform Cloud's functionality. By automating the provisioning and management of infrastructure, organizations can reduce human error and increase efficiency. Key automation features include:

    • Plan and Apply: Terraform Cloud automates the "plan" and "apply" stages of infrastructure deployment. Users can preview changes before applying them, ensuring that modifications align with expectations.

    • Run Triggers: Terraform Cloud supports run triggers that automatically initiate runs in dependent workspaces when changes occur in another workspace. This feature streamlines workflows and enhances responsiveness to changes.

  3. State ManagementManaging state files is a critical aspect of using Terraform effectively. Terraform Cloud simplifies state management by offering:

    • Remote State Storage: State files are stored securely in Terraform Cloud, allowing for easy access and collaboration among team members.

    • State Locking: To prevent conflicts during simultaneous operations, Terraform Cloud automatically locks state files during updates, ensuring data integrity.

  4. Policy Enforcement and GovernanceGovernance is essential for maintaining compliance and security in cloud environments. Terraform Cloud provides robust policy enforcement features:

    • Sentinel Policy as Code: Sentinel allows organizations to define policies that govern how infrastructure can be provisioned. This ensures that all deployments adhere to organizational standards and compliance requirements.

    • Role-Based Access Control (RBAC): With RBAC, organizations can manage user permissions effectively, ensuring that only authorized personnel can make changes to critical infrastructure.

  5. Enhanced Security

Security is a paramount concern for organizations managing sensitive data in the cloud. Terraform Cloud offers several security features:

  • Secrets Management: Sensitive information such as API keys and passwords can be securely stored within Terraform Cloud, reducing the risk of exposure.

  • Audit Logs: Comprehensive audit logs provide visibility into who made changes to infrastructure configurations, enabling organizations to track modifications for compliance purposes.

  1. Multi-Cloud Support

In an era where businesses often operate across multiple cloud providers, having a tool that supports multi-cloud environments is crucial:

  • Consistent Management Across Providers: Terraform's provider ecosystem allows users to manage resources across various cloud platforms (e.g., AWS, Azure, Google Cloud) using a unified configuration language. This consistency simplifies operations and reduces complexity.

  1. Scalability and Flexibility

As organizations grow, their infrastructure needs evolve. Terraform Cloud is designed to scale alongside your organization:

  • Dynamic Scaling: Users can easily adapt their infrastructure configurations to accommodate changing workloads or new projects without extensive reconfiguration.

  • Modular Infrastructure: By leveraging reusable modules, teams can standardize configurations across projects while maintaining flexibility.

  1. Cost Management

Managing costs effectively is essential for any organization utilizing cloud resources:

  • Cost Estimation Tools: Terraform Cloud offers cost estimation features that allow users to assess potential expenses before deploying new resources.

  • Resource Optimization: By automating resource provisioning and decommissioning unused resources promptly, organizations can optimize their cloud spending.
